Jane Seagrave Exiting The AP For Martha’s Vineyard Paper

Mar 4, 2011 11:25 AM

Associated Press Chief Revenue Officer Jane Seagrave is stepping down from her post and leaving the news wire to become publisher of the Vineyard Gazette, which is based in Martha’s Vineyard, the paper announced.

AP Promotes Seagrave To Chief Revenue Officer; Brettingen Retiring

Jan 28, 2010 2:24 PM

Associated Press vet Jane Seagrave has been promoted to the second-highest job at the news coop. Effective March 1, Seagrave will be chief revenue officer, the job held by Tom Brettingen since 2008.
